Understanding Teenage Grief 

Unlike adults who may have more developed coping mechanisms, teens often struggle to understand and articulate their feelings. Their reactions may vary from silence and withdrawal to anger and defiance. Some may immerse themselves in school or social activities as a distraction, while others isolate themselves completely. These varied responses are not signs of disrespect or indifference—they are expressions of inner turmoil that they might not yet know how to handle. 


Funeral homes can play a critical role by offering structured settings and supportive services that validate these emotional responses. By creating a safe space where grief is acknowledged and respected, teens are given permission to mourn in their own way and at their own pace.

Encouraging Expression Through Personalization 

Personalized funeral services can be particularly impactful for grieving teenagers. Allowing them to write letters to the deceased, share photos, or speak during the service gives them a channel for emotional expression. Funeral directors who understand the nuances of teen behavior can gently guide families toward options that include the younger members in the grieving process. 


For example, offering the opportunity to create a memory table with artwork or notes, or even contributing to a digital slideshow, allows teens to process grief in creative ways. Such personalized elements make the service not just a farewell, but a meaningful interaction with memories. 


The Importance of Language and Communication 

Communicating with teens during times of grief requires sensitivity. The language used by funeral staff should be clear, compassionate, and appropriate. Abstract phrases like "passed on" can confuse younger adolescents, while terms like "died" may offer the clarity they need to begin processing the reality of loss. 


Funeral professionals in Chaska are trained to communicate with families across generations, and their ability to engage teenagers without overwhelming them is essential. When teens feel respected in conversation, they are more likely to ask questions and open up about their feelings.
